A targeted, clinically informed regimen involving the administration of specific micronutrients, peptides, or neuroactive compounds designed to optimize cerebral function and neuroplasticity beyond standard nutritional intake. This approach aims to support neurotransmitter balance, enhance mitochondrial efficiency within neurons, and fortify the blood-brain barrier integrity. It represents a sophisticated strategy for maximizing cognitive reserve and performance across the lifespan.
Origin
This term is a modern clinical-wellness construct, combining the concepts of “advanced,” implying sophisticated and targeted science, and “brain supplementation,” the act of adding specific substances for cerebral benefit. Its origin lies in the intersection of nutritional neuroscience, endocrinology, and longevity medicine, focusing on optimizing the brain’s environment for hormonal signaling.
Mechanism
The mechanism involves leveraging specific compounds to modulate key neuroendocrine pathways, such as the synthesis of brain-derived neurotrophic factor (BDNF) or the regulation of HPA axis activity. These supplements often function as cofactors for enzymatic reactions critical to neurotransmitter synthesis or act directly on neuronal receptors. The ultimate goal is to enhance synaptic function and protect against oxidative stress, thereby supporting the brain’s hormonal responsiveness.
